The Story Behind Yung-Chieh
Yung-Chieh (永傑) is a Chinese name, typically composed of two characters. The first character, 'Yung' (永), means 'eternal' or 'forever,' conveying a sense of longevity, permanence, and enduring quality. The second character, 'Chieh' (傑), means 'hero,' 'outstanding,' or 'distinguished,' suggesting excellence, talent, and remarkable achievement. The combination of these characters creates a name that wishes for the individual to be eternally outstanding or a hero forever.
Chinese names are often chosen for their auspicious meanings and the positive qualities they evoke. The specific characters used can vary, leading to different nuances in meaning, even if the pronunciation is similar. The choice of 'Yung' and 'Chieh' reflects a desire for the child to possess lasting virtues and to achieve greatness throughout their life. This name is used for both males and females, though the specific characters chosen might sometimes lean towards one gender in common usage.
